软件工程作业
NanoNino
只为了方便个人记录
展开
-
实验三 面向对象分析与设计
1、了解基于UML的面向对象分析与设计方法2、掌握用例图的绘制、用例规约(文档)的编制3、掌握类图、活动图、状态图、时序图的绘制方法原创 2020-12-21 12:35:00 · 2475 阅读 · 0 评论 -
实验二 结构化分析与设计
(1)参考一个熟悉的系统,如,机票预订系统/教材订购系统/ATM自动取款机,讨论其用户需求、系统需求和业务需求;(2)绘制系统的分层数据流图,并给出数据字典;(3)将系统的分层数据流图映射为软件结构图,绘制软件结构图;(4)为关键模块进行详细设计,如绘制关键模块的流程图;(5)实现系统部分功能并测试。原创 2020-11-30 16:34:48 · 6565 阅读 · 0 评论 -
ATM管理系统
编写一个ATM管理系统,语言不限,要求应包括以下主要功能:(1)开户,销户(2)查询账户余额(3)存款(4)取款(5)转账(一个账户转到另一个账户)等...原创 2020-11-15 22:20:29 · 473 阅读 · 0 评论 -
流程图与活动图的区别与联系
举例分析流程图与活动图的区别与联系1. 给出流程图的定义说明2. 给出活动图的定义说明3. 举例对比流程图与活动图的区别4. 举例分析流程图与活动图的联系原创 2020-11-08 12:38:13 · 8275 阅读 · 1 评论 -
四则运算出题程序
写一个能自动生成小学四则运算题目的程序,然后在此基础上扩展: 1)除了整数以外,还要支持真分数的四则运算,例如:1/6+1/8=7/24 2)程序要求能处理用户的输入,判断对错,累积分数 3)程序支持可以由用户自行选择加、减、乘、除运算 4)使用-n参数控制生成题目的个数,例如Myapp.exe -n 10,将生成10个题目原创 2020-11-03 00:08:00 · 1438 阅读 · 0 评论